CLIFF OMORUYI GAME LOG:
3/14/24 vs Maryland:
Rutgers season finale ended in a 65-51 loss in the first round of the Big 10 Tournament Wednesday Night. Cliff had 2 points, 5 rebounds, and added a steal and 2 blocks on the defensive side of the ball.
3/10/24 vs Ohio State:
Omoruyi led the way with 10 points, 7 rebounds, and 1 block on Rutgers Senior Day as they lost 73-51 to Ohio State.
3/7/24 vs Wisconsin:
The Scarlet knights dropped their second game in a row as they were downed by Wisconsin 78-66 Thursday night. Omoruyi finished the game with 7 points, 5 rebounds, 2 steals, and 3 blocks.
3/3/24 vs Nebraska:
Omoruyi finished with 6 points and 2 rebounds in 22 minutes on the floor as Rutgers fell to Nebraska 67-56 Sunday night.
2/29/24 vs Michigan:
Omoruyi had his way Thursday night vs Michigan. He dropped 19 points, shooting 82% from the field and scooped up 15 rebounds for a double double. On the defensive side of the ball he added a steal and had 2 more blocks, as Rutgers cruised to a massive 30 point victory.
2/25/24 vs Maryland:
Rutgers dropped their second game in a row as they fell to Big 10 foe Maryland 63-46. Omoruyi finished with 5 points, 4 rebounds, and 3 steals in 17 minutes.
2/22/24 vs Purdue:
Omoruyi and Rutgers fell to #3 ranked Purdue 96-68 Thursday night. Cliff finished with 4 points, 3 rebounds, and added a steal in 24 minutes on the floor.
2/18/24 vs Minnesota:
Omoruyi shined as Rutgers had their four game winning streak snapped Sunday Evening vs Minnesota. In 31 minutes, Cliff posted 19 points, 8 rebounds, 3 blocks, and 3 steals, while shooting 60% from the field.
2/15/24 vs Northwestern:
Rutgers grabbed their fourth win in a row, as they squeaked by Northwestern 63-60 Thursday night. In a season high 34 minutes, Cliff dropped 9 points, 9 rebounds, and added 5 more blocks and 2 steals on the defensive side of the ball.
2/10/24 vs Wisconsin:
Omoruyi led the charge as Rutgers knocked off #11 ranked Wisconsin Saturday afternoon. Cliff had a historic night posting 13 points, 13 rebounds, and a game high 8 blocks for the second time this season.
2/6/24 vs Maryland:
Rutgers picked up their second win in a row, taking down Big 10 foe Maryland, in a 56-53 nail-biter. Cliff posted 8 points, 5 rebounds, and 3 blocks in 22 minutes.
2/4/24 vs Michigan:
Omoruyi had a big night in Rutgers thrilling comeback victory vs Michigan. Cliff put up 15 points on 67% shooting, grabbed 11 boards, and added an assist and a block. It was his seventh double-double of the season, and his 27th all time, putting him atop the list of Rutgers double-doubles in the last 30 seasons.
1/31/24 vs Penn State:
Rutgers dropped their third game in a row, as Penn State cruised to a 61-46 win. Omoruyi saw 29 minutes on the floor, putting up 8 points, 6 rebounds, and 3 blocks on the night.
1/28/24 vs Purdue:
Omoruyi and Rutgers fell just short against #2 ranked Purdue, Sunday afternoon. In a 68-60 finish, Cliff dropped 13 points on 50% shooting from the field and grabbed 6 rebounds.
1/21/24 vs Illinois:
The Scarlet Knights fell 86-63 to nationally ranked Illinois Sunday afternoon. Cliff dropped 22 points and grabbed 9 boards in the loss.
1/16/24 vs Nebraska:
Omoruyi and the Scarlet Knights battled Nebraska all the way to OT, coming out on top 87-82. Cliff had a monster night on the floor putting up 14 points, 15 rebounds, and 4 blocks. This marks Omoruyi’s sixth double-double this season.
1/14/24 vs Michigan State:
Omoruyi logged 20 minutes on the floor registering 4 points, 8 rebounds, and 2 blocks in a blowout loss to Big-10 foe Michigan State.
1/9/24 vs Indiana:
Omoruyi and the Knights bounced back with a commanding 66-57 win Tuesday Night. Cliff saw 32 minutes on the floor posting 5 points, 11 rebounds and 5 blocks.
1/3/24 vs Ohio State:
Rutgers couldn’t make it two in a row as they fell 76-72 in a tense in-conference Big-10 Matchup to Ohio State. Cliff finished with 7 points and 7 rebounds in 28 minutes on the floor while shooting 3/4 (75%) from the free throw line on the night.
12/30/23 vs Stonehill College:
Omoruyi had a monster night posting 17 points and 17 rebounds in a tight 59-58 victory over Stonehill College. Cliff added 3 more blocks on the night to go along with his fifth double-double of the season.
12/23/23 vs Mississippi St:
It was a quiet afternoon for Omoruyi and Rutgers. Cliff finished the game with 3 points and 1 block in a 70-60 loss.
12/16/23 vs LIU:
Omoruyi led the way for the Scarlet Knights registering a career high 25 points in a 83-61 blowout win vs LIU Saturday Afternoon. On the glass he added 11 rebounds which marked his fourth double-double of the season, while also registering another 3 blocks on the defensive side of the ball.
12/10/23 vs Seton Hall University:
Rutgers bounced back with a tight 70-63 win over in-state rival Seton Hall University. Cliff recorded his third double double of the season and added 7 blocks on the defensive end of the floor, while also reaching the 1000 point milestone as the 46th player in Rutgers Basketball history.
12/6/23 vs Wake Forest University:
Rutgers lost their second straight as they fell 76-57 in a blowout loss to Wake Forest. Cliff posted 4 points and 4 rebounds in 27 minutes on the floor.
12/3/23 vs Illinois:
Omoruyi and the Scarlet Knights fell 76-58 to #24 Illinois Saturday Night at the Jersey Mike’s Center. Cliff recorded 7 points and 9 rebounds, while adding 8 blocks on the defensive side of the ball.
11/27/23 vs Saint Peter’s University:
Rutgers cruised to a 71-40 win Monday Night vs Saint Peter’s University. Cliff finished with a season-high 17 points on 50% shooting from the field, and grabbed 8 rebounds. Defensively, he posted 4 blocks on the night as well to help Rutgers claim their fifth straight victory.
11/19/23 vs Howard:
It was a night to remember for Big Cliff and Rutgers. Omoruyi led the charge with his second double-double of the season finishing with 15 points and 14 rebounds on the night. He also added 4 blocks and 2 steals to cap off an impressive 85-63 win over the Howard Bison.
11/15/23 vs Georgetown University:
Omoruyi and Rutgers knocked off Georgetown 71-60 Wednesday night at Jersey Mike’s Arena in Piscataway, NJ. Cliff contributed with 8 points on 4-7 (57%) shooting from the floor, 6 rebounds and added 4 blocks to help the Scarlet Knights improve to 3-1 on the season.
11/13/23 vs Bryant University:
Rutgers earned their second straight win defeating Bryant University 66-57 in a tight game Sunday night. In 27 minutes of game time, Cliff posted 13 points and grabbed 15 rebounds for his first official double-double of the season.
11/10/23 vs Boston University:
Rutgers secured their first victory of the 23-24 season Friday night in a blowout 20 point win defeating Boston University 69-45. Cliff picked up 5 points and 5 rebounds on the night while shooting a stellar 75% from the free throw line.
11/6/23 vs Princeton:
Omoruyi and the Scarlet Knights kicked off the 23-24 regular season with a hard fought 68-61 defeat to Princeton University. In 27 minutes of game time, Cliff shot 50% from the field, while leading the team with 12 points on the night. In addition, Omoruyi scooped up 7 rebounds, had a steal and assist a piece while also racking up 4 blocks.
10/21/23 vs St. John’s:
Rutgers opened the 23-24 campaign with a 89-78 preseason loss to St.John’s. Omoruyi dropped 16 points & collected 9 rebounds while shooting an even 50% from the field on the night.
